The cheapest way to get from Droux to Magnac-Laval is to line 226 bus which costs €1 - €3 and takes 8 min.
The fastest way to get from Droux to Magnac-Laval is to taxi which takes 7 min and costs €17 - €21.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Bourg and arriving at Magnac-Laval - Mairie. Services depart once a week, and operate Wednesday. The journey takes approximately 8 min.
The distance between Droux and Magnac-Laval is 8 km.
The best way to get from Droux to Magnac-Laval without a car is to line 226 bus which takes 8 min and costs €1 - €3.
The line 226 bus from Bourg to Magnac-Laval - Mairie takes 8 min including transfers and departs once a week.
Droux to Magnac-Laval bus services, operated by Transports de la Haute-Vienne (RRTHV), depart from Bourg station.
Droux to Magnac-Laval bus services, operated by Transports de la Haute-Vienne (RRTHV), arrive at Magnac-Laval - Mairie station.
